How Whoop Works Membership
Whoop membership system works in a certain manner before termination. Whoop operates on a subscription-based model, unlike traditional fitness trackers which need to be purchased once. By signing up, you normally have an option of paying monthly or yearly where you get the device and access to the analytics platform.
Your subscription will automatically renew at the conclusion of every billing period unless you cancel. This implies that unless you act before your renewal date, you will be forced to renew again. Also, there might be a minimum period of commitment to certain plans, particularly when you were offered the device at a reduced price.
Knowing such information helps you not to be surprised and makes sure that you cancel in time.
How to cancel Whoop Membership step-by-step
Cancellation of subscription is not a complex task, but it is important to use the right steps. The following is the way you can do it:
Firstly, visit your Whoop account in the official site or in the application. After logging in, go to your account settings. Find a section that has Membership or Billing.
Then, locate the manage or cancel subscription. When you click on it, you will most likely be offered some choices including pausing your membership rather than cancelling. In case you are certain that you want to cancel, then go with the cancellation option.
You might be requested to clarify your choice or give a reason of exit. Finish the confirmation procedure, and ensure that you get a cancellation confirmation e-mail. This email is important as proof that your subscription has been successfully canceled.
When you subscribed via a third party platform such as Apple or Google Play, you will have to cancel via the third party site rather than directly on the Whoop site.
Typical Problems and Prevention
Most users are faced with issues on how to cancel their subscriptions, most of them being a result of minute details. The most prevalent being the forgetting to cancel prior to the renewal date. Whoop subscriptions are also automatic, which means that failure to do this within this window might lead to another payment.
The other problem is canceling via the incorrect platform. When you subscribed via either the App Store or Google Play, cancellation on the Whoop website will not prevent the billing. Always verify where you subscribed to.
Confirmation emails are also ignored by some users. In case you do not get one, then you should check again on your account or call the customer care to confirm that you were canceled.
Being attentive to such details can assist you in preventing unwarranted stress and bills.
Billing and Refund Policy
The refund policy of Whoop may differ according to the plan and area. In most instances, subscriptions cannot be refunded after a billing cycle has begun. It translates to the fact that should you cancel during a billing period, you will still be able to access it until the end of the period, but will not be refunded unused time.
Nevertheless, certain users can receive refunds in certain circumstances, including technical problems or premature terminations in a trial period. Always a nice thought to revisit the official terms of Whoop or their support.
Additionally, remember that you are not deactivated when you cancel your membership. You can keep on taking the service at the conclusion of your billing cycle.

FAQs
How to cancel Whoop membership easily?
You can cancel your membership by logging into your account, going to the billing section, and selecting the cancel option.
Can I cancel my Whoop membership anytime?
Yes, you can cancel anytime, but the cancellation will take effect at the end of your current billing cycle.
Will I get a refund after canceling Whoop membership?
In most cases, refunds are not provided once a billing cycle has started.
What happens after I cancel my Whoop membership?
You will continue to have access until the end of your billing period, after which your membership will end.
Do I need to return the Whoop device after canceling?
Generally, you do not need to return the device, but it may no longer function fully without an active membership.
Can I pause my Whoop membership instead of canceling?
Yes, Whoop may offer a pause option depending on your plan and account status.
